Q: Is 105,757,112 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 105,757,112 is a composite number.

Why is 105,757,112 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 105,757,112 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 457 914 1,828 3,656 28,927 57,854 115,708 231,416 13,219,639 26,439,278 52,878,556 and 105,757,112, with no remainder.

Since 105,757,112 cannot be divided by just 1 and 105,757,112, it is a composite number.
